Duties

- Responsible for the planning, programming, and accomplishments of the Staffing and Classification division. Sets priorities, organizes work and staff assignments to promote productivity and efficiency of operation while providing job satisfaction and developmental opportunities. - Develops programs and procedures, criteria, and instructions for the guidance of operating officials and human resources staff necessary to implement Office of Personnel Management, Department, Bureau and Regional Office policy and requirements in the areas of staffing and classification. - Develops programs and procedures to implement Reclamation policy relative to placement of Reclamation personnel. Administers Merit Promotion and Delegated Examining Programs, staffing, placement follow-up, and as needed, reduction in force and outplacement of surplus employees. - Carries out a schedule of periodic reviews of HR operations accomplished by Human Resources Specialists and Assistants or as problem situations arise. - Provides management advisory services to regional management and supervisors at all levels to explain Reclamation, DOI, and other applicable policies and procedures related to staffing and classification and human resources concepts and principles. - Researches and analyzes a variety of unusual conditions, problems, or questions that may arise.

Qualifications

In order to be rated as qualified for this position, the HR Office must be able to determine that you meet the specialized experience requirement below- this information must be clearly supported in the resume. HR will not make assumptions. GS-13: To qualify at the GS-13, your resume must reflect one year of full time experience (see resume requirements below) leading teams and projects in the areas of staffing and/or classification; recruiting for and staffing a wide variety of positions, including GS and craft (FWS, BB, WB, or WG) positions; using delegated examining, merit promotion, and special (noncompetitive) hiring authorities; and/or advising supervisors on position management and classifying both supervisory and nonsupervisory positions. Experience ref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service programs (e.g.,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ional; philanthropic; religious; spiritual; community, student, social). Volunteer work helps build critical competencies, knowledge, and skills and can provide valuable training and experience that translates directly to paid employment. You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ience. Time-In-Grade: Current career or career-conditional employees of the Federal government, or former career or career-conditional employees, who have a break in service of less than one year, are required to meet the time-in-grade restriction of one year of Federal experience at the next lower-grade, with few exceptions outlined in 5 CFR 300.603(b). You must meet all Eligibility and Qualification requirements, including time-in-grade restrictions and any selective placement factors if applicable, by 10/17/2024.
